Concepcion is a term with multiple meanings depending on the context. In a religious context, particularly within Christianity, "Concepcion" refers to the Immaculate Conception of Mary, the belief that Mary was conceived without original sin. This doctrine is central to Catholic theology and is celebrated annually on December 8th. The concept emphasizes Mary's purity and her unique role as the mother of Jesus.
